Nov.24   Cambodians turn out to honor the dead   Hundreds of somber-faced Cambodians assembled in front of the suspension bridge where hundreds of people died in a stampede during a festiv... Nov.22   350 die in stampede at festival
Map of Phnom Penh Cambodia
  A stampede that occurred in capital city during the Water Festival has killed 339 people. Another 329 people were injured in the crush
 Huge crowds had gathered on a small island for the final day of the one of the main events of the year in Cambodia; a bridge become overcrowded. The swaying of the bridge near Phnom Penh, triggered a panic. Some people were crushed on the bridge, while others fell into the river and drowned
